"I composed this album "Nostalghia" after being inspired by several transparency films my grandmother had left me. The films were taken in 1967 during her travels in Britain, France, Italy, Denmark, Germany, the Soviet Union, USA and so on. She had rarely told me about her travels, (I am not sure why), except for a few funny stories. Nostalghia is the process of my efforts through composition in approaching a memory embraced in those film." - Marihiko Hara

Marihiko Hara is a sound artist and composer residing in Kyoto, Japan primarily working in the field of electronic and acoustic music for theatre and film, performance and visual arts. Thus far, at the age of 30, Marihiko has released albums with Home Normal and audiobulb (UK), Tench (US), leerraum (CH), Drone Sweet Drone (FR), Shrine and nightcruising (JP). "Credo" released by Home Normal (UK) was selected for the shortlist Best of 2011, Music For Sonic Installations (Headphone Commute).
